This stylish property positioned in the ever-popular suburb of Yalyalup, offers that perfect lifestyle with local parks and Georgiana Molloy Anglican school close by. Only a short distance to local sporting fields or Western Growers Fresh for all your gourmet foodie needs. Busselton town centre offers an array of local cafes and restaurants to select from, or why not check out the newly developed foreshore, Geographe Bay, Busselton Jetty or the playground ideal for the kids.
This spacious home features a chef's kitchen with a Bellissimo oven, perfect for entertaining as well as a breakfast bar, loads of bench space and walk-in pantry. Spacious open plan living and dining areas made comfortable by a Fujitsu reverse cycle air-conditioning and cozy wood fireplace. Sit back and relax to your favourite movie in the front theatre room creating another living space to utilise. The master bedroom is located at the rear with a walk-in robe, great size ensuite and views over the backyard.
Step outside from the main living area to the undercover outdoor alfresco area overlooking the shady backyard from the peppermint trees. A powered shed tucked away in the corner is ideal for the gardening equipment or extra storage. Other great features include a battery system with 12 x solar panels, reticulated front lawns and an automatic double garage. This property is the ideal investment opportunity as it's currently tenanted at $690 per week.
